摘要
Complex studies of the electromagnetic field influence in a wide range (sound - IR) of frequencies upon the non-Josephson oscillation (NJO) effect am reported. The changes in the effect parameters and simultaneously in the energy gap due to the external radiation power are examined. It is shown that with frequency changing from a value lower than 1/tau(epsilon) to a value exceeding 1/tau(epsilon) the character of the influence produced by the external electromagnetic field intensity upon the order parameter changes too - from suppression to stimulation. This leads to an increase in the NJO frequency in the former caw or its decrease in the latter case. At frequencies close to that of the NJO the sample behaves like a nonlinear parametric system. The results obtained support the basic issues of the model proposed to explain the NJO effect.
